Upper limits on O VI Emission From Voyager

Abstract

We have examined 426 {\it Voyager} fields distributed across the sky for \ion{O}{6} (λλ\lambda \lambda 1032/1038 \AA) emission from the Galactic diffuse interstellar medium. No such emission was detected in any of our observed fields. Our most constraining limit was a 90% confidence upper limit of 2600 \phunit on the doublet emission in the direction (l, b) = (117\fdegree3, 50\fdegree6). Combining this with an absorption line measurement in nearly the same direction allows us to place an upper limit of 0.01 cm3^{-3} on the electron density of the hot gas in this direction. We have placed 90% confidence upper limits of less than or equal to 10,000 \phunit on the \ion{O}{6} emission in 16 of our 426 observations.
